Josh Nasser (born 23 June 1999 in Australia)[1] is an Australian rugby union player who plays for the Queensland Reds in Super Rugby. His playing position is hooker. He has signed for the Reds squad in 2020.[2][3][4][5]

He is the son of 1991 World Cup Wallaby Brendan Nasser and also has a sister, Isabella Nasser, who plays for Australia’s world champion women's rugby sevens team.[6]
